Web25 okt. 2024 · A timeshare is a shared piece of vacation real estate that allows multiple owners to share the same property in different time increments. Typically, timeshare owners will stay at a property for a one-week interval each year. Web16 okt. 2015 · Right-to-use timeshares are similar to deeded timeshares, but you only have it for a particular length of time (i.e. 50 years). Your right to use that timeshare goes away once that duration has surpassed, at which point it reverts back to the landowner. WebSource: Bloomberg New Energy Finance. Note: 2016 figures as of 30 September 2016. Companies’ financing requirements change dramatically as they mature, both in terms of scale and type. This is illustrated in Figure 2 below. At the seed stage, firms look for amounts up to $1m, typically equity from the founder and angel investors, or grants. Web30 mrt. 2024 · A delivered cost of green hydrogen of around $2/kg ($15/MMBtu) in 2030 and $1/kg ($7.40/MMBtu) in 2050 in China, India and Western Europe was achievable, while costs could be 25% lower in countries with the best renewable and hydrogen storage resources, such as the US, Brazil, Australia, Scandinavia and the Middle East. The difference is, you pay each time for the cost of staying there. Other vacation clubs claim that, once you enroll, you’ll get discounts on travel, lodging, or other amenities related to a vacation.
